WebIf your property is in band A, your council tax bill will be reduced by 17% instead - this is because band A is the lowest band. Ask your local council if you can get a ‘disabled person’s reduction’. You can find your council's contact details on GOV.UK. Some local councils ask for extra evidence - for example, a doctor’s letter. WebThe Disabled Homeowners’ Exemption (DHE) provides a reduction of 5 to 50% on New York City's real property tax to low-income homeowners with disabilities. To be eligible for DHE, you must have a disability, earn no more than $58,399 for the last calendar year, and the property must be your primary residence.
